Skip to main content

Credit Card Fraud Detection with Artificial Immune System

  • Conference paper
Artificial Immune Systems (ICARIS 2008)

Part of the book series: Lecture Notes in Computer Science ((LNTCS,volume 5132))

Included in the following conference series:

Abstract

We apply Artificial Immune Systems(AIS) [4] for credit card fraud detection and we compare it to other methods such as Neural Nets(NN) [8] and Bayesian Nets(BN) [2], Naive Bayes(NB) and Decision Trees(DT) [13]. Exhaustive search and Genetic Algorithm(GA) [7] are used to select optimized parameters sets, which minimizes the fraud cost for a credit card database provided by a Brazilian card issuer. The specifics of the fraud database are taken into account, such as skewness of data and different costs associated with false positives and negatives. Tests are done with holdout sample sets, and all executions are run using Weka [18], a publicly available software. Our results are consistent with the early result of Maes in [12] which concludes that BN is better than NN, and this occurred in all our evaluated tests. Although NN is widely used in the market today, the evaluated implementation of NN is among the worse methods for our database. In spite of a poor behavior if used with the default parameters set, AIS has the best performance when parameters optimized by GA are used.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Brownlee, J.: Artificial immune recognition system (airs) - a review and analysis. Technical report, Victoria, Australia: Centre for Intelligent Systems and Complex Processes (CISCP), Faculty of Information and Communication Technologies (ICT), Swinburne University of Technology (January 2005)

    Google Scholar 

  2. Charniak, E.: Bayesians networks without tears. AI Magazine (1991)

    Google Scholar 

  3. DasGupta, D.: Artficial Immune Systems and Their Applications. Springer, New York (1998)

    Google Scholar 

  4. de Castro, L.N., Timmis, J.: Artificial Immune Systems: A Novel Paradigm to Pattern Recognition. University of Paisley (2002)

    Google Scholar 

  5. Elkan, C.: The foundations of cost-sensitive learning. In: IJCAI, pp. 973–978 (2001)

    Google Scholar 

  6. Fan, W., Stolfo, S.J., Zhang, J., Chan, P.K.: AdaCost: misclassification cost-sensitive boosting. In: Proc. 16th International Conf. on Machine Learning, pp. 97–105. Morgan Kaufmann, San Francisco (1999)

    Google Scholar 

  7. Holland, J.: Adaptation in Natural and Artificial Systems, 1st edn. MIT press, Cambridge (1975)

    Google Scholar 

  8. Hopfield, J.J.: Neural networks and physical systems with emergent collective computational abilities. In: Proceedings of the National Academy of Science, vol. 79, pp. 2554–2558 (1982)

    Google Scholar 

  9. Kim, J., Zeigler, B.P.: A framework for multiresolution optimization in a parallel/distributed environment: simulation of hierarchical gas. J. Parallel Distrib. Comput. 32(1), 90–102 (1996)

    Article  Google Scholar 

  10. Klarreich, E.: Inspired by immunity. Nature (415), 468–470 (2002)

    Article  Google Scholar 

  11. Maes, S., Tuyls, K., Vanschoenwinkel, B.: Machine learning techniques for fraud detection (2000)

    Google Scholar 

  12. Maes, S., Tuyls, K., Vanschoenwinkel, B., Manderick, B.: Credit card fraud detection using bayesian and neural networks. In: Proceedings of NF 2002, Havana, Cuba, January 16-19 (2002)

    Google Scholar 

  13. Murthy, S.K., Ohlebusch, E., Kurtz, S.: Automatic construction of decision trees from data: A multi-disciplinary survey. In: Data Mining and Knowledge Discovery, USA, vol. 2, pp. 345–389. Kluwer Academic Publishers, Dordrecht (1998)

    Google Scholar 

  14. Phua, C., Lee, V., Smith, K., Gayler, R.: A comprehensive survey of data mining-based fraud detection research. Artificial Intelligence Review (submitted for publication, 2005)

    Google Scholar 

  15. Schapire, R.E., Singer, Y.: Improved boosting using confidence-rated predictions. Machine Learning 37(3), 297–336 (1999)

    Article  MATH  Google Scholar 

  16. Stolfo, S., Fan, W., Lee, W., Prodromidis, A., Chan, P.: Credit card fraud detection using meta-learning: Issues and initial results, 1997. In: Working notes of AAAI Workshop on AI Approaches to Fraud Detection and Risk Management (1997)

    Google Scholar 

  17. Watkins, A., Timmis, J., Boggess, L.: Artificial immune recognition system (AIRS): An immune-inspired supervised machine learning algorithm. Genetic Programming and Evolvable Machines 5(3), 291–317 (2004)

    Article  Google Scholar 

  18. Witten, I.H., Franku, E.: Data Mining: Practical Machine Learning Tools and Techniques, 2nd edn. Elsevier, Amsterdam (2005)

    MATH  Google Scholar 

  19. Witten, I.H., Franku, E.: Software documentation: Weka (2008), Weka-3-4-11.doc/weka/classifiers/functions/MultilayerPerceptron.html

Download references

Author information

Authors and Affiliations

Authors

Editor information

Peter J. Bentley Doheon Lee Sungwon Jung

Rights and permissions

Reprints and permissions

Copyright information

© 2008 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Gadi, M.F.A., Wang, X., do Lago, A.P. (2008). Credit Card Fraud Detection with Artificial Immune System. In: Bentley, P.J., Lee, D., Jung, S. (eds) Artificial Immune Systems. ICARIS 2008. Lecture Notes in Computer Science, vol 5132.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-85072-4_11

Download citation

  • DOI: https://doi.org/10.1007/978-3-540-85072-4_11

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-85071-7

  • Online ISBN: 978-3-540-85072-4

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ics